Course Description

Cedar Crest is a golf club located in Murfreesboro, Tennessee, offering a 6,828-yard par-72 course set on roughly 175 acres with bent grass greens and bermuda fairways. The layout features four sets of tees, cedar-lined fairways, and a log cabin clubhouse, providing a peaceful yet challenging golfing experience for players of all skill levels. The club emphasizes its course tour, practice amenities, and pro shop, with event spaces and dining options as part of the clubhouse experience. Cedar Crest serves the Middle Tennessee region, focusing on quality playing surfaces and a tranquil retreat.

How difficult is Cedar Crest Golf Club for mid-handicap golfers?

Players often find Cedar Crest Golf Club technically exacting. The 131.0 slope indicates balanced but noticeable difficulty. The course rating of 72.7 reflects on scoring relative to par 72.

What tees should a 15 handicap play at Cedar Crest Golf Club?

A 15 handicap golfer should consider tees closer to 6072 yards. The back tees extend to 6828.0 yards, which makes approach shots longer and scoring more challenging.

What is considered a good score at Cedar Crest Golf Club?

With a course rating of 72.7 and par 72, a mid-handicap golfer would typically score in the mid to high 80s. Stronger players aiming to break 72 must manage approach shots and avoid penalty strokes.

How long is Cedar Crest Golf Club and how does yardage affect play?

Stretching to 6828.0 yards from the back tees, approach shot length becomes a consistent scoring factor.

What type of course is Cedar Crest Golf Club and how should I play it?

The course follows a traditional Parkland design philosophy. Overall, the setup will reward players who place the ball in safe positions far from hazards. Also, type of shot is more crucial rather than just trying to gain distance.

What features make Cedar Crest Golf Club strategically challenging?

The combination of a slope rating of 131.0 and yardage reaching 6828.0 yards creates consistent pressure on approach shots. You will need to balance risk and reward, especially on longer par 4s and protected greens.
